Knowledge & learning in Vatican City

Vatican City and its immediate surroundings offer a rich landscape for those drawn to knowledge. Historic libraries — among them the Biblioteca Angelica, Biblioteca Casanatense, Biblioteca Vallicelliana and the Bibliotheca Hertziana — hold centuries of manuscripts, printed works and art-historical research. Ancient structures add further depth: the Arch of Constantine, the Arch of Janus, the Auditorium of Hadrian and the Baths of Diocletian reflect layers of Roman building tradition. The Botanical Garden provides a space for natural study, while sites such as Caelian Hill, the Capanne Romulee and the Castrum Caetani connect urban history with archaeological inquiry.
